<BLOCKQUOTE class="ip-ubbcode-quote"><font size="-1">quote:</font><HR> What is an Action-Reverse Wager?

An Action-Reverse wager is a pair of Action-To wagers. The pairs are made by taking the original Action-To wager and placing another Action-To wager in reverse order. Action-Reverse wagers are accepted for 2 and 3 plays, on football sides and totals only.

Following is a breakdown of a 2 play Action-Reverse wager.

$100 Action-Reverse on Play-A in Game-1 and Play-B in Game-2.

$110 to win $100 on Play-A in Game-1.
if the above wager wins or pushes:
$110 to win $100 on Play-B in Game-2.
and

$110 to win $100 on Play-B in Game-2.
if the above wager wins or pushes:
$110 to win $100 on Play-A in Game-1.

Payouts for a $100 2 Play Action-Reverse wager based on $110 to win $100 plays.
Number
of Wins Number
of Pushes Number
of Losses Win or
Loss Amount
2 0 0 Win $400
1 1 0 Win $200
0 2 0 No Action
1 0 1 Lose $120
0 1 1 Lose $220
0 0 2 Lose $220
Payouts for a $100 3 Play Action-Reverse wager based on $110 to win $100 plays.
Number
of Wins Number
of Pushes Number
of Losses Win or
Loss Amount
3 0 0 Win $1200
2 1 0 Win $800
1 2 0 Win $400
2 0 1 Win $160
0 3 0 No Action
1 1 1 Lose $140
0 2 1 Lose $440
1 0 2 Lose $460
0 1 2 Lose $660
0 0 3 Lose $660

<BLOCKQUOTE class="ip-ubbcode-quote"><font size="-1">quote:</font><HR> What is a Conditional Wager?

A Conditional wager is a group of bets on two to three outcomes placed at the same time.

There are two types of conditional wagers, IF-THENs and ACTION-TOs. Conditional wagers are useful for placing bets on wagers that go at the same time. You can also place a conditional wager where the later game goes first. The order does not have to be in the same order as the game times. These wagers are different from parlays since you don't have to re-invest all of your winnings in the subsequent games.

Conditional wagers are accepted on totals and sides.

Typical IF-THEN bet

$110 to win $100 on Team A in game 1
If the above wager wins then
$110 to win $100 on Team B in game 2
If the above wager wins then
$110 to win $100 on Team C in game 3.

If Team A does not win, you have NO ACTION on Team B or Team C.
If Team B does not win, you have NO ACTION on Team C.

If all 3 win you win $300.
If Team A loses you lose $110.
If Team A wins and Team B loses you lose $10.
If Team A wins, Team B wins, and Team C loses, you win $90.

It is not necessary to bet the same amount on all three games. An ACTION-TO wager is similar and contains the phrase "If the above wager wins or pushes".

IF-THEN's

If the first wager wins then the following wager has action.
If the second wager wins then the third wager has action.
If any wager in the IF-THEN bet loses or pushes all of the following wagers are NO ACTION.
ACTION-TO's

If the first wager wins or pushes then the second wager has action.
If the second wager wins or pushes then the third wager has action.
If any wager in the ACTION-TO bet loses then all of the following wagers are NO ACTION. <HR></BLOCKQUOTE>
